What is Apprl.dll?

A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is a type of file that contains code and data that can be used by multiple programs at the same time. These files help save memory space and make it easier to update and maintain software. apprl.dll is a specific DLL file that is linked to the software McAfee Host Intrusion Prevention.

This DLL file plays a crucial role in the functioning of the McAfee software, providing essential functions and resources that the program needs to operate effectively. In the context of McAfee Host Intrusion Prevention, apprl.dll is important because it provides support for various security features, such as identifying and preventing potentially harmful behaviors on a computer network. Without apprl.dll, the McAfee software may not be able to carry out its intrusion prevention functions properly, which could leave computer systems vulnerable to security threats.

Therefore, the proper functioning of apprl.dll is vital for ensuring the overall security and stability of the McAfee Host Intrusion Prevention software.

D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.

  • Apprl.dll could not be loaded: This error suggests that the system was unable to load the DLL file into memory. This could happen due to file corruption, incompatibility, or because the file is missing or incorrectly installed.
  • The file apprl.dll is missing: This message means that the system was unable to locate the DLL file needed for a particular operation or software. The absence of this file could be due to a flawed installation process or an aggressive antivirus action.
  • Apprl.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error suggests that the DLL file may not be built to run on your current version of Windows, or it might be corrupted. A possible cause could be a mismatch in system architecture - for example, trying to use a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system.
  • Apprl.dll not found: The required DLL file is absent from the expected directory. This can result from software uninstalls, updates, or system changes that mistakenly remove or relocate DLL files.
  • Apprl.dll Access Violation: This points to a situation where a process has attempted to interact with apprl.dll in a way that violates system or application rules. This might be due to incorrect programming, memory overflows, or the running process lacking necessary permissions.

Run the Windows Memory Diagnostic Tool

Run the Windows Memory Diagnostic Tool Thumbnail

How to run a Windows Memory Diagnostic test. If the apprl.dll error is related to memory issues it should resolve the problem.

Step 1: Open Windows Memory Diagnostic

Step 1: Open Windows Memory Diagnostic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Windows Memory Diagnostic in the search bar and press Enter.

Step 2: Start the Diagnostic Process

Step 2: Start the Diagnostic Process Thumbnail
  1. In the Windows Memory Diagnostic window, click on Restart now and check for problems (recommended).

Step 3: Wait for the Diagnostic to Complete

Step 3: Wait for the Diagnostic to Complete Thumbnail
  1. Your computer will restart and the memory diagnostic will run automatically. It might take some time.

Step 4: Check the Results

Step 4: Check the Results Thumbnail
  1. After the diagnostic, your computer will restart again. You can check the results in the notification area on your desktop.

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the memory diagnostic, check if the apprl.dll problem persists.

Update Your Device Drivers

In this guide, we outline the steps necessary to update the device drivers on your system.

Step 1: Open Device Manager

Step 1: Open Device Manager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Device Manager in the search bar and press Enter.

Step 2: Identify the Driver to Update

Step 2: Identify the Driver to Update Thumbnail
  1. In the Device Manager window, locate the device whose driver you want to update.

  2. Click on the arrow or plus sign next to the device category to expand it.

  3. Right-click on the device and select Update driver.

Step 3: Update the Driver

Step 3: Update the Driver Thumbnail
  1. In the next window, select Search automatically for updated driver software.

  2. Follow the prompts to install the driver update.

Step 4: Restart Your Computer

Step 4: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. After the driver update is installed, restart your computer.
